WebDec 14, 2024 · While adverbs and adjectives are both parts of speech that are used to describe something, the difference between them is what they describe: Adjectives describe nouns and pronouns, while adverbs are used to describe verbs, adjectives, or other adverbs. WebUsually slow is used as an adjective and slowly is used as an adverb, but slow can also be used as an adverb.
